Gathering Essential Info
When you're developing a funeral pamphlet, what vital details do you require to include? Start with click the up coming site of the departed, together with their days of birth and death.
Next, add a quick biography that highlights their life, accomplishments, and passions.
It's additionally vital to provide the details of the service, such as the day, time, and place, so guests know where to go.
Do not forget to consist of information regarding any type of visitation hours and burial or cremation information.
If there are any special demands, like contributions to a charity, see to it to mention those as well.
Lastly, take into consideration adding a purposeful quote or poem that shows the deceased's spirit, making the pamphlet more personal and memorable.
Creating the Layout and Visual Components
After collecting the essential info for the funeral service pamphlet, it's time to concentrate on how to offer it visually. Start by choosing a tidy, easy-to-read format. Use clear headings and subheadings to lead the visitor.
Think about a well balanced setup of text and images-- way too much text can overwhelm, while too many images can sidetrack. Opt for a relaxing color scheme that mirrors the deceased's character or the tone of the solution. Select legible typefaces, and prevent overly decorative styles that might impede readability.
